@import url("css/menu.css");

/* CSS Document */
#Body {background:#f0edea url(images/body_bg.png) repeat-x top left; height:100%; margin:0; padding:0; }

/* ControlPanel style */
.ControlPanel{ border-bottom: solid 1px #cccccc; border-left: solid 1px #cccccc; border-right: solid 1px #cccccc; border-top: none;}


/*-------- Default Style --------*/
body,th,td,table,h1,h2,h3,h4,h5,h6,.Normal,.NormalDisabled,.Head,.SubHead,.SubSubHead, a:link, a:visited, a:hover, input, .CommandButton{color:#5e5e5e; font-family: Arial, Helvetica, sans-serif;}
body,th,td,table,.Normal,.NormalDisabled,.Head,.SubHead,.SubSubHead, a:link, a:visited, a:hover{font-size:12px;}
h1, h2, h3, h4, h5, h6, h2 input{color:#515151;font-weight:bold;margin:1ex 0;}
h1{font-size:18px;margin:10px 0;}
h2, h2 input{font-size:14px;}
h3{font-size:13px;}
h4{font-size:12px;}
h5{font-size:11px;}
h6{font-size:10px;}

a,a:link,a:visited,a:active{color:#5e5e5e; text-decoration:none; font-weight:normal; }
a:hover{color:#333333; text-decoration:underline;}
.Head, .SubHead, .SubSubHead, .Normal, .NormalDisabled, .NormalDisabled, .NormalBold, .NormalRed, .NormalTextBox
{font-family: Arial, Helvetica, sans-serif;}
.Head{color:#5e5e5e;font-weight:bold;}
.SubHead {color:#5e5e5e;}
.SubSubHead{color:#5e5e5e;}
.NormalRed {color:#F00;}

/*Datagrids */
.DataGrid_Container {margin-top:15px;}
.DataGrid_Header{font-weight:bold;}
.DataGrid_Header td, .NormalBold td{font-weight:bold;}

/*-------- design style --------*/
#s_wrap_main{display:table;width:950px; margin:0 auto; }
#s_wrap_sub{display:table-row; border-left: solid 1px #cccccc; }
.template_style{display:table-cell; background-color:#ffffff; padding-left: 20px; padding-right: 20px; }

.top_space{height:34px; }
.lang_pad{padding:7px 0 0 25px;float:left;}

.logo_top_left{padding:0; margin:0; background:url(images/logo_top_left.png) no-repeat top left; height:23px;}
.logo_top_right{padding:0; margin:0; background:url(images/logo_top_right.png) no-repeat top right;}
.logo_top_bg{padding:0; margin:0 39px 0 27px; background:#FFF url(images/logo_top_bg.png) repeat-x top;height:23px;}
.logo_left{padding:0; background:url(images/logo_left.png) repeat-y top left;}
.logo_right{padding:0; background:url(images/logo_right.png) repeat-y top right;}
.logo_pad{background:#FFF; margin: 0 19px 0 7px; padding:0 0 10px 10px;height:100%;}

.top_group0{padding:0; width: 226px; height: 11px; border-right: solid 1px #dbd9d7; border-left: solid 1px #dbd9d7; float: left;}
.top_group1{padding:0; width: 227px; height: 11px; border-right: solid 1px #dbd9d7; float: left;}
.top_group3{padding:0; width: 226px; height: 11px; border-right: solid 1px #dbd9d7; float: left;}
.top_group5{padding:0; width: 226px; height: 11px; border-right: solid 1px #dbd9d7; float: left;}

.bot_group1{padding:0; width: 227px; height: 21px; border-right: solid 1px #dbd9d7; float: left;}
.bot_group3{padding:0; width: 226px; height: 21px; border-right: solid 1px #dbd9d7; float: left;}
.bot_group5{padding:0; width: 226px; height: 21px; border-right: solid 1px #dbd9d7; float: left;}

.group0{padding:0; background:url(images/logo.jpg); width: 226px; height: 109px; border-right: solid 1px #dbd9d7; border-left: solid 1px #dbd9d7; float: left;}
.group1{padding:0; background:url(images/group1.jpg); width: 227px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group3{padding:0; background:url(images/group3.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group5{padding:0; background:url(images/group5.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}

.group2{padding:0; background:url(images/group2.jpg); width: 227px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group4{padding:0; background:url(images/group4.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group6{padding:0; background:url(images/group6.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}

.group1_roll{padding:0; background:url(images/group1_roll.jpg); width: 227px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group2_roll{padding:0; background:url(images/group2_roll.jpg); width: 227px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group3_roll{padding:0; background:url(images/group3_roll.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}
.group4_roll{padding:0; background:url(images/group4_roll.jpg); width: 226px; height: 44px; border-right: solid 1px #dbd9d7; float: left;}

.creative{padding:0; background:url(images/SCFgroup_home.jpg); width: 908px; height: 315px; border-right: solid 1px #dbd9d7; border-left: solid 1px #dbd9d7; float: left;}

.s_logo{float:left;}
.s_banner{background:#aaa;width:50%;float:right;}

.menu_bg{padding:0 0 0 6px;  margin: 0 21px 0 9px; background:url(images/menu_bg.png) top left;}
.menu_left{padding:0; margin:0; background:url(images/menu_left.png) repeat-y  top left;}
.menu_right{margin:0; background:url(images/menu_right.png) repeat-y top right; }

.search_style{float:right; height:40px;}
.search_bg{padding: 7px 0 0 0;}

.bread{padding:  10px 0 0  10px;  height:35px; float: left;}

#login_style{ float:right; line-height:34px; padding-right:18px;}
#bread_style{ float:left; line-height:34px; padding-left:18px; color:#000000;}

.center_bg{padding:0; margin:0;clear:both;}
.content_pad{padding:10px 22px 0 22px; margin: 0 19px 0 7px; background:#FFF url(images/keylines.jpg) repeat-y bottom left;}
.lm_content_pad{padding:0; margin:0;}
.content_width{padding-top:15px; min-height:350px;}
.lm_content_width{padding-top:0px; min-height:192px;}

.bot_bg{padding:0; margin:0; background:url(images/bot_bg.png) repeat-x top left; height:36px;}

.bot_pad{margin-bottom:20px;padding:0 20px 0 0;background-color:#ffffff;}
#footer_col1{float:left; width: 228px}
#footer_col2{float:left; width: 227px}
#copy_style{float:left;}

.clear_float{clear:both; line-height:0; font-size:0; height:0;}

/* ------- FileManager -------*/
div.FileManager{height:auto;border:none;}
table.FileManager{width:99%}


a.CommandButton:link, a.CommandButton:visited{color:#CB2027; font-weight:bold; text-decoration:none;}
a.CommandButton:hover{color:#5e5e5e; text-decoration:underline;}

/*-------ControlPanel changes ---------------*/
.ControlPanel a.CommandButton:link, .ControlPanel a.CommandButton:visited{color:#5e5e5e;}
.ControlPanel a.CommandButton:hover{color:#CB2027; text-decoration:underline;}
.ControlPanel a.CommandButton:link, .ControlPanel a.CommandButton:hover, .ControlPanel a.CommandButton:visited, .ControlPanel .SubHead{
font-size:11px;}
.ControlPanel a[disabled="disabled"]{color:#888 !important;text-decoration:none !important;}

/*--------- pane style ----------*/
.BannerPane {display:inline-block;float:right;padding-right:17px;width:auto;}
.TopPane, .BottomPane{ padding:0; margin:0;}
/*
.MenuPane{ padding:0; width:455px; margin:0; background-color: #5e5e5e; float: left; min-height: 192px; background:#5e5e5e url(images/dash.jpg) repeat-x bottom left; }
.LeftPane{ padding:0; width:218px; margin:0 0 0 10px; float: left;}
.RightPane{ padding:0; width:217px; margin:0 0 0 10px; float: left;}
*/
.MenuPane{ padding:0; width:228px; margin:0; background-color: #5e5e5e; float: left; min-height: 192px; background:#5e5e5e url(images/dash.jpg) repeat-x bottom left; }
.LeftPane{ padding:0; width:444px; margin:0 0 0 10px; float: left; border-right: solid 1px #dcd9d7; min-height: 192px;}
.RightPane{ padding:0; width:210px; margin:0 0 0 10px; float: left;}
.ContentPane{ padding:0; width:665px; margin:0 0 0 10px; float: left;}


/*------------ Breadcrumb Style --------------*/
.Breadcrumb,a.Breadcrumb:link,a.Breadcrumb:active,a.Breadcrumb:visited{color:#5e5e5e;}
a.Breadcrumb:hover{color:#333333;text-decoration:none;}

/*-------------- Link Style --------------*/
.linkscontainer{padding-top:20px;text-align:center;}
.links,a.links:link,a.links:active,a.links:visited{ font-weight:bold; color:#5e5e5e; text-transform:uppercase;}
a.links:hover{color:#333333;}

/*-------------- User Style --------------*/
.user,a.user:link,a.user:active,a.user:visited { color:#5e5e5e;}
a.user:hover{color:#333333;}

/*-------------- Footer Style --------------*/
.footer,a.footer:link,a.footer:active,a.footer:visited { color:#8b8970;}
a.footer:hover{color:#333333;}

/*-------------- Empty panes Style --------------*/
.DNNEmptyPane{width:0;padding:0;margin:0;}

/*-------------- Search SkinObject Styles --------------*/
div.SearchContainer{position:relative; white-space: nowrap;}
div.SearchBorder{width: 168px; height: 24px; border: solid 1px #999999; float:left; background-color: White; white-space: nowrap; margin-top: 0px;}
div.SearchContainer a{padding: 0; display: block; float:left; }
div.SearchContainer a img{padding-left:0px;}
div.SearchIcon{float: left; width: 31px; height: 20px; cursor: pointer; z-index: 11; background: no-repeat 2px 2px; text-align:right;}
div.SearchIcon img{margin-top: 3px;}

input.SearchTextBox{float: left; z-index: 10; border: 0; width:160px; height:18px; margin-left:5px; margin-top:3px; color: #333333;}
input.SearchTextBoxDef{float: left; z-index: 10; border: 0; width:160px; height:18px; margin-left:5px; margin-top:3px; color: #cccccc;}

#SearchChoices{clear: both; display: none; border: solid 1px #C3D4DF; z-index: 2000; cursor: pointer; margin: 0; padding: 0; text-align:left; background-color: #F3F7FA; position:absolute; top: 22px; left: 0;}
#SearchChoices li{cursor: pointer; margin: 0; padding: 2px 2px 0 2px; padding-left: 25px; height: 18px; text-align:left; background-color: #F3F7FA; background-repeat: no-repeat; background-position: 2px center; list-style: none; list-style-image: none; border: none; display:block;}
#SearchChoices li.searchHilite{background-color: #CE0D0D;	color:#ffffff; border: none;}
#SearchChoices li.searchDefault{background-color: #F8FAFF; border: none;}

.link-list .icon, .icon {
background-position:left center;
background-repeat:no-repeat;
padding-left:20px;
}
a.icon, span.icon, li.icon {
}
a.icon:not([classname~="icon"]), span.icon:not([classname~="icon"]) {
display:inline-block;
vertical-align:bottom;
}
li.icon, p.icon {
background-position:left top;
}
.pdf-file {
background-image:url(icons/pdf.gif);
}
.stamp { color:#888888;}

.arrow
{
  background-position: right top;
  background-repeat:no-repeat;
  padding-right:12px;             
  background-image:url(icons/arrow.png);
  font-weight: bold;
}


























